COMSEC
Short Title - Answer-series of letters and numbers used to facilitate identification, handling, accounting,
and control of COMSEC material
Effective Key - Answer-key that is in the current period of time allowed for use
3 categories of COMSEC material - Answer-equipment, keying material, COMSEC aids
CONAUTH - Controlling Authority - Answer-manages traditional COMSEC material, evaluates COMSEC
incidents, authorizes issue/destruction of COMSEC material, releases a Controlling Authority Status
Message for all keys they control, and directs the operation of a cryptonet
Command Authority (CA or CMDAUTH) - Answer-manages modern key assets for a department, agency,
or command, grants privileges to User Representatives (URs) and associated key ordering privileges, and
validates CF Form 1206 before submission to Central Facility (CF)
Asymmetric/Modern Key - Answer-a collection of asymmetric key such as Secure Data Network System
(SDNS) FIREFLY key, and Message Signature Key (MSK)
Traditional Key - Answer-managed by Controlling Authority, distributed, effective and supersession
dates, copied
, Modern Key - Answer-managed by CMDAUTH, ordered, expiration (12 months from date of generation),
moved when issued
CF1200 - Answer-Closed Partition Registration Request: used to establish a closed partition
CF1201 - Answer-CMDAUTH Registration Request: used to establish a new CMDAUTH or modify/delete
an existing one
CF1202 - Answer-DAO Registration Request: same purpose as the CF1207 (UR DAO Privilege Request).
establish a new DAO code or modify/delete the description or entire code for an existing DAO
CF1205 - Answer-User Representative Partition Privilege Registration Request: used to assign a closed
partition privilege
CF1206 - Answer-User Representative Registration Request: used to establish or modify/delete an
already established UR. must be accurate and up to date at all times
CF1207 - Answer-User Representative DAO Privilege Registration Request: used to establish a new DAO
code or modify/delete the description or entire code for an existing DAO. also used to
modify/add/delete a Class 6 Code
DAO Code - Answer-Department, Agency, Organization (DAO) codes identify a caller during a secure
session and identify those privileged to order modern keying material. It's a 6-digit number that
represents 2 lines of data:
USN, MSC (Military Sealift Command), USCG, USMC
Line 2 is geographic location or DEPLOYED
Class 6 Codes - Answer-2-digit numeric codes associated with a special description and tied, by key order
privileging to a DAO code.
